在python代码里是什么意思

Python 代码中 <> 的含义

在python代码里是什么意思

在 Python 编程语言中,<> 符号表示比较运算符,用于比较两个值并返回一个布尔值(True 或 False)。此外,这些符号还用于定义列表和字典等数据结构。

比较运算符

<> 作为比较运算符,用于比较两个值并返回以下布尔值之一:

  • True:如果第一个值大于、小于、等于或不等于第二个值
  • False:如果第一个值不满足上述条件

以下示例演示了比较运算符在 Python 中的使用:

“`python
num1 = 5
num2 = 10

print(num1 > num2) # False
print(num1 < num2) # True
print(num1 == num2) # False
print(num1 != num2) # True
“`

数据结构定义

在 Python 中,<> 符号也用于定义列表和字典等数据结构。

列表

列表是由一组按顺序排列的值组成的。它们使用方括号 [] 定义,其中值用逗号分隔。

python
my_list = [1, 2, 3, 4, 5]

字典

字典是键值对的集合,其中键是唯一标识符,值与键相关联。它们使用大括号 {} 定义,其中键和值用冒号分隔。

python
my_dict = {
"name": "John Doe",
"age": 30,
"city": "New York"
}

嵌套的 <> 符号

在某些情况下,<> 符号可以嵌套使用,以创建更复杂的数据结构或比较多个值。

嵌套列表

嵌套列表是可以包含其他列表的列表。它们使用以下语法定义:

python
my_list = [[1, 2, 3], [4, 5, 6], [7, 8, 9]]

嵌套字典

嵌套字典是可以包含其他字典的字典。它们使用以下语法定义:

python
my_dict = {
"name": "John Doe",
"info": {
"age": 30,
"city": "New York"
}
}

多重比较

在 Python 3.8 及更高版本中,<> 符号可以嵌套用于多重比较。以下是语法:

python
a < b < c
a > b > c

此语法检查 a 是否分别小于 bb 小于 c,或 a 是否大于 bb 大于 c

相关问答

  1. 在 Python 中,>< 符号表示什么?
    答:比较运算符,用于比较两个值并返回布尔值。

  2. 如何使用 <> 符定义列表?
    答:使用方括号 [],其中值用逗号分隔。

  3. 如何使用 <> 符定义字典?
    答:使用大括号 {},其中键和值用冒号分隔。

  4. 什么是嵌套列表?
    答:可以包含其他列表的列表。

  5. 什么是多重比较?
    答:用于比较多个值(仅在 Python 3.8 及更高版本中可用)。

原创文章,作者:孔飞欣,如若转载,请注明出处:https://www.wanglitou.cn/article_113698.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-07-17 03:25
下一篇 2024-07-17 03:29

相关推荐

公众号